🎯 Understanding This Ratio

This is the official ratio reported to the U.S. Department of Education, calculated using Full-Time Equivalent (FTE) students and faculty. FTE adjusts for part-time enrollment and staffing, giving a more accurate picture of actual class sizes than raw headcounts. This is the same ratio shown on College Navigator and used in official comparisons.
